In recent years the rub-off effect from iPhones and iPads certainly has helped Apple’s market-share, since in real-world terms the latest iteration of Windows isn’t the dog that it used to be (it’s actually very good), and all the major photography apps such as Photoshop and Lightroom work identically on both platforms.īut since a lot of us are unrepentant Macheads the announcement in early June, 2012 of the Macbook Pro with Retina display ( MBP Retina) was of great interest for a variety of reasons. Some people just prefer the Mac OS, for others its the svelte industrial design, while for some it’s been the availability of Firewire 800, allowing for very fast external bus-powered drives and card readers. On one of my Antarctic expeditions a few years ago I actually did a head count, and out of 56 laptops 43 were Macbook Pros. Many use Windows machines at work, but when I see them on location as many as 80% are traveling with Macbook Pros. It’s been my experience, working with photographers all over the world at my workshops and seminars, that the vast majority use Mac laptops.
